    Not going to lie- the place is nice- the drink menu is nice- the service is nice and the food looked nice as well...buuuuuutttt we ordered the fried tofu , McBau , cod balls and duck wings. The $7 spent for just one Bau that was the size of a tennis ball that is supposed to taste like a $5.25 Mcdonalds sandwich just didn't make sense to me. Anything for the snap right? It was good- but my mind was not blown. Actually is was barely impressed. General Tso Crispy Confit Duck Wings was good bang for your buck and it actually tasted decent. The drumstick on the duck wing is the same size as a chickens leg drumstick. So it was a decent portion. The sauce and garnish was nice. Again this time i was satisfied- at best! The disappointment of the night came with KFC Popcorn Tofu and it is probably why I could not enjoy the rest of my meals as much. SALT! biting into felt like I dove head first into the dead sea. Beer and other garnishes couldn't wash away the saltiness it left on my tongue. However, we did tell the server and they knocked it off the bill. Which was really great service The cod balls were great and the drink menu was amazing. This place is a great place to hang out and have drinks and nibble. Maybe I went on an off night. Damn you Tofu!

    We ended up here by accident. We couldn't get into La Carnita next door because of the ridiculous 2-hour wait, and DaiLo was packed - but by chance and kismet, LoPan (DaiLo's second floor tapas-style snack bar) had a table available, so following the orders of our hungry stomachs, despite knowing nothing about the restaurant, we took a chance and had dinner here instead. We're so glad we did - sometimes, go with your gut. Stumbling upon even a random snack bar can bring you a satisfying, memorable meal. First, the parking situation is decent. A block east of the restaurant are several small side streets where you can find free parking. If you can't find any, a decent amount of street parking around the restaurant is available. Second, the service. I just wanted to commend how wonderfully accommodating, professional, and friendly the staff were. They were aware of my shellfish allergy from the outset, and went out of their way to ensure that the Jellyfish Slaw salad wasn't "shellfish" and made sure I was able to eat it. Third, the food. Keep in mind that the orders here are all snack-size, appetizer-style, so don't expect a full-sized meal. We ordered: a) the Jellyflish Slaw, b) Truffle Fried Rice, c) Big Mac Bao (1 piece), d) Korean BBQ short ribs, e) KFC popcorn tofu. The Truffle Fried Rice and the Jellyfish Slaw were definitely the stand-outs - delicious flavours melding sweet and salty with the comforting feeling of chomping on fried rice, along with really interesting textures in the Jellyfish Slaw (it wasn't slimy, but super crunchy and delicious). I would pass on the Korean BBQ ribs (it's basically something you can make at home, and is really nothing special). Overall, for portion size, the value isn't that great (I don't think $19 for the Truffle Fried Rice was warranted, given how small the portion was). But, regardless, the quality of the food is there, and it was a great meal. For two people, with tax and tip, we paid around $63.

    Found this cocktail bar through a friend and immediately made a reservation after seeing the menu…read more The ingredients are complex but intentional, with East Asian influences. I found myself wanting to try most of the cocktails, which is a rarity. We got the Strawberry Tetsu to start (inspired by Uncle Tetsu's Japanese cheesecake), along with the Cloudy Oolong (tea-based cocktail with a salted caramel cheese foam). The Strawberry Tetsu tasted like a dessert and was delicious, with a graham cracker crumble rim. The Cloudy Oolong had a strong tea taste which I loved, as sometimes the tea can get lost in a cocktail. The foam on top was addicting and paired nicely with it, similar to a bubble tea. Next, I had the Burnt Yuzu which was light and refreshing from the citrus. The bar is hidden behind Misfit Ice Cream, with a speakeasy vibe to the interior. Large windows line one wall with a view to the exterior, but are tinted enough that people walking by cannot see in. Service was great, although they do have a strict 1 hr 45 min time limit for seating, regardless of whether the bar is packed or not.
